Changelog — Week 37, Brightmoor eng sync. As part of migrating the Fenwick pipeline to the hermetic Ostrava build system, we rotated the release signing material. The old key was minted on the legacy runner fleet, which the hermetic sandbox cannot reach, so keeping it would have broken provenance attestation. All builds from tag v9.1 onward are signed under the new key; older artifacts remain verifiable against the archived chain. For attestation tooling, the new key is recorded below.

release key, hagug-yaguf: bky13_NnhXrmFGhCRtW

Minutes — Management Meeting, Brindlecote Holdings

Present: all department heads. Agenda item: proposed joint venture with Ferrowyn Systems covering shared manufacturing capacity in the Caldmere region. Discussion covered capital contributions, governance split, and IP protections. Legal flagged outstanding warranty questions; finance confirmed modelling is on track. Heads are asked to submit risk assessments before the next session. The chair's confidential note on strategic intent follows below.

board note of baweg-bawig: Project Tamath slips by six weeks because of the audit delay.

MINUTES — Management Meeting, Support Outsourcing

Attendees: Sales leads, ops, finance.

1. Tier-1 support for Quillbase to move to Averton Services, Kirnwall site. Pilot: 90 days.
2. Headcount impact: 14 roles redeployed internally; no redundancies this phase.
3. SLA targets unchanged; escalations stay in-house.
4. Sales leads to brief key accounts before announcement. No external comms until contract signed.
5. Finance projects 18% cost reduction year one.

The rationale ties to the plan noted below.

internal memo for tadup-yajop: Briysox Group is in early talks to buy Oliathox Partners for about $3.4 million. The Sordor launch date is July 17, and nothing goes to the press before then.